What's The Definition Of Unitarian Universalism?

Unitarian Universalism in American English
noun: a North American liberal religious denomination in the Judeo-Christian heritage, formed in 1961 by the merger of the Unitarians, organized in 1825, and the Universalists, organized in 1793
